History of Universities: Volume XXXI / 1Mordechai Feingold Oxford University Press, 4 juni 2018 - 280 sidor This issue of History of Universities, Volume XXXI / 1, contains the customary mix of learned articles and book reviews which makes this publication such an indispensable tool for the historian of higher education. The volume is, as always, a lively combination of original research and invaluable reference material. |
